Transaction 687eafbe24c85d68725ce01a10d76503369f09229b74208cad5b5f4c6a2023ae
1 Input
1 Output
-
687eafbe24c85d68725ce01a10d76503369f09229b74208cad5b5f4c6a2023ae:0
- value
- 39919483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b57aa1b0d36971f7ddbd8dbe4ab7e1684f1bf01 OP_EQUAL
- address
- 3FrPgK3oRVJYyhDA1nTTiGS8obwL96ULMf